A city administrator contacted MTAS regarding the town doing drainage work on private property. Public Works Consultant John Chlarson responded to the request, explaining that the water issue is causing damage to the town's right of way. It is recommended that the ditch be rechannelized and that channel and bank protection should be installed.

An ordinance limiting the power of taxation conflicts with the charter and general law.

Although it is a violation of the Tennessee Code for an elected official to serve as a registrar in an election, such circumstances will not lead to an invalidation of the election results.
